winter-born.NET takes its name from a horribly addictive Cruxshadows song, which someone used in a Weiß Kreuz Gluhen video and got permanently stuck in both our heads. I'd like to say that we had some profound reason for choosing the name, but really it just sounds nice and we were staring at the CD case while trying to find a domain name that hadn't already been taken.

The term 'winter born' sounds pretty, but it's not actually a good thing. As far as we can tell from the context of the song it's probably an oblique reference to an old British tradition of sacrificing infants born around the time of the solstice to ensure that the coming year would be fruitful for the rest of the community.
